Archives

What is Full-Term Match?

June 20, 2017

Full term match is one of the matching option supported by SearchIQ. It lets a user query matches your posts/products whenever “all terms” in the user query is found on the posts/products regardless the ordering. This option allows you to increase the coverage of your posts/products but still keep a high relevancy.

Continue Reading

What is Broad Match?

June 20, 2017

Broad match is the default matching option that SearchIQ uses. It lets a user query matches your posts/products whenever someone searches for that phrase, similar phrases, singular or plural forms, misspellings, synonyms, stemmings (such as floor and flooring), related searches, and other relevant variations. This option allows you to increase the coverage of your posts against user query but it also gives a chance for some not highly relevant posts and products to be shown. To migrate the irrelevancy issue, SearchIQ will rank the most relevant posts and products at the top of the result. Some of our users use this option along with field weight specified. This gives them better control the ranking of the matched posts/products.

Continue Reading

What is the Phrase Match?

June 20, 2017

Phrase match is one of the keyword matching options SearchIQ provided. It allows you to match user query in exact form from any of the fields indexed. For example, if user types “tennis shoes”, the posts/products contain “tennis shoes” with other terms before or after the phrase will be shown, but not for “shoes for tennis”, or “tennis sneakers”. Phrase match is more targeted than broad match and full term match.

However, if you feel this match option is too restricted. You can consider to use broad match and full term match. Both of these matching options support phrase match with quotes before and after the search query.

Continue Reading

What is the difference between SearchIQ Free and paid license ?

June 14, 2017

SearchIQ is working our best to make site search a great experience to users. So, we have given out lots of premium features to FREE accounts. However, there are a set of features we keep it for our paid users. They are listed as below:

  1. Higher limit in amount of documents for paid account.
  2. Faceted search
  3. Cross-domain search capability
  4. Hosted post and product thumbnails on our own image servers and distribute them out on CDN networks for fast performance.
  5. Larger time range in analytic reports.
  6. PDF file support
  7. White labeling that allows you to remove our logo.
  8. and more…

And we will constantly add more features to our paid service.

Continue Reading

What is the XPath and how to use it to improve the crawler accuracy?

June 14, 2017

XPath is a query language which provide easy way to select node from an XML/HTML document. You can read more about the language here.

Below we provide some examples:

  • Post title: /html/head/title
  • Short description: /html/head/meta[@name="description"]/@content
  • Post image: //div[@id="container"]/article/img/@src
  • Post content: //div[@id="container"]/article
  • Post author: //div[@id="container"]/span[@id="author"]

If you have different html structure for every post content you can set two or more XPath queries separated by comma.

Continue Reading